top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                以太坊轻开发:助力区块链应用普及的最佳选择

                • 2025-12-20 13:55:20
                  ``` ## 内容主体大纲 1. **引言** - 以太坊的崛起 - 轻的定义与重要性 2. **以太坊轻的基本概念** - 什么是轻? - 与全节点的对比 - 轻的工作原理 3. **轻的开发流程** - 需求分析 - 技术选型 - 开发环境搭建 - 编码实现 - 测试与部署 4. **以太坊轻的核心功能** - 交易管理 - 密钥管理 - 用户界面设计 - 安全性设计 5. **以太坊轻的安全性考虑** - 安全风险分析 - 私钥保护措施 - 防止重放攻击 - 使用多重签名技术 6. **市场需求与商业价值** - 当前市场现状 - 投资回报分析 - 不同行业的应用潜力 7. **未来发展趋势** - 技术进步对轻的影响 - 生态系统的扩展 - 用户需求变化 8. **常见问题解答** - 以太坊轻的安全性如何? - 轻与全节点哪个更安全? - 如何选择适合自己需求的轻? - 如何确保轻中的资产安全? - 以太坊轻的开发费用大概多少? - 有哪些成功的轻开发案例? ## 引言

                  以太坊是一个开源的区块链平台,以其强大的智能合约功能著称,是去中心化应用(DApp)开发的热门选择。伴随以太坊生态的蓬勃发展,轻作为一种新兴的数字资产管理工具,日益受到重视。本文将对以太坊轻的开发进行深入探讨,分析其市场需求、核心功能及安全性考虑,并介绍开发过程中需注意的细节。

                  ## 以太坊轻的基本概念 ### 什么是轻?

                  轻是一种不需要下载整个区块链的数据文件的数字。用户只需下载一些必要的信息,即可进行资产的管理和交易。相较于全节点,轻大大降低了对存储空间和网络带宽的要求,适合移动设备和资源受限的环境。

                  ### 与全节点的对比

                  全节点需要保留整个区块链的数据,为用户提供完全的节点验证与交易历史。但这也会造成巨大的存储需求和更高的系统要求。而轻则通过与全节点建立连接,获取必要的数据,以便于用户随时随地管理其资产。

                  ### 轻的工作原理

                  轻主要通过简化支付验证协议(SPV)与区块链节点进行交互,用户的交易信息不会被保存在本地,而是通过网络请求实时获取。这种设计不仅减少了存储需求,还能加快交易确认的速度。

                  ## 轻的开发流程 ### 需求分析

                  在开始开发之前,需要详细分析用户需求和市场趋势,包括哪些功能是用户最需要的,怎样的用户体验更会吸引用户。此外,还要考虑轻的目标用户群体,如普通用户、企业用户等,各类用户的需求可能截然不同。

                  ### 技术选型

                  轻的开发需要选择合适的技术栈,包括前端框架、后端语言及数据存储方案。常用的前端框架有React、Vue等,后端则可以选择Node.js、Python等。此外,选择合适的以太坊开发库(如web3.js)也是至关重要的。

                  ### 开发环境搭建

                  搭建开发环境是开发的第一步,包括配置开发工具、安装必要的依赖库等。开发者需要根据所选技术栈准备好IDE、Git、Docker等工具,以确保开发过程顺利进行。

                  ### 编码实现

                  在进行代码实现时,需遵循良好的编程规范,确保代码的可维护性和可读性。轻功能的实现包括用户注册、资产管理、交易功能等。每一个模块的开发都需进行详细的单元测试,确保其正确性和稳定性。

                  ### 测试与部署

                  开发完成后,进行全面的测试是非常重要的一步。在测试阶段,应包括功能测试、安全性测试以及性能测试,确保轻在不同场景下的稳定性。测试通过后可进行部署,通常选择云服务商来实现项目上线。

                  ## 以太坊轻的核心功能 ### 交易管理

                  交易管理是轻的核心功能之一,用户需要能够方便地进行资产转账、充值和查看历史交易记录。为此,轻应具备友好的界面和快速的交易确认机制。

                  ### 密钥管理

                  密钥管理至关重要,用户的私钥是其资产安全的保证。轻应采用先进的加密技术,确保用户私钥不易被盗取。此外,可以通过助记词等方式帮助用户安全地存储和恢复他们的私钥。

                  ### 用户界面设计

                  用户体验是轻成功的关键。一款好的轻应具备直观的用户界面,友好的操作流程,以便于各类用户轻松上手。UI/UX设计应重视导航的易懂性及操作的流畅性,同时应结合市场反馈不断。

                  ### 安全性设计

                  轻的安全性设计需要考虑多个方面,包括网络安全、数据安全等。实施HTTPS、数据加密及防火墙技术,可以显著提高的整体安全性。同时,定期更新和安全监测也是必要的措施。

                  ## 以太坊轻的安全性考虑 ### 安全风险分析

                  轻面临的安全风险主要包括私钥泄露、重放攻击等。了解并分析这些风险是确保轻安全的前提,开发者需根据风险点设计 mitigation 措施,以降低潜在的安全隐患。

                  ### 私钥保护措施

                  保护用户私钥是轻安全的重中之重。可采用加密存储、分布式存储等方式来提高私钥的安全性。此外,提示用户定期更换密钥和使用强密码也是有效的保护措施。

                  ### 防止重放攻击

                  重放攻击发生在用户的交易内容被恶意复制并再次提交的情况下。为避免重放攻击,轻可以引入 nonce(随机数)机制,为每笔交易生成唯一标识,确保交易在区块链上的唯一性。

                  ### 使用多重签名技术

                  多重签名技术能够显著增强的安全性。用户可设置多个签名地址,必须由多个设备或用户共同确认后,资产才能完成转账。这种方式可有效防止单点故障和盗窃。

                  ## 市场需求与商业价值 ### 当前市场现状

                  随着区块链技术的不断普及,轻的市场需求也在逐渐上升。目前市场上已有多个轻应用,但大部分仍存在用户体验和安全性的问题。因此,开发高质量的以太坊轻仍有很大的市场空间。

                  ### 投资回报分析

                  轻开发的投资回报率主要取决于市场需求和用户数量。通过一个稳定的商业模式,例如交易手续费、增值服务等,可以有效提升投资回报。开发团队应对目标市场进行深入调研,以制定合理的商业策略。

                  ### 不同行业的应用潜力

                  轻不仅适用于加密货币交易,还可应用于供应链金融、物联网等多个行业。随着区块链技术的不断成熟和应用场景的扩大,其市场潜力不可小觑,成为许多企业的新业态合作方向。

                  ## 未来发展趋势 ### 技术进步对轻的影响

                  随着技术的不断进步,轻的功能将越来越强大。不仅限于数字货币,还可能支持多种资产类型,例如NFT资产、跨链资产等。轻的复杂性需与日俱增,公司需不断进行技术创新以满足市场需求。

                  ### 生态系统的扩展

                  未来,以太坊轻将持续融入更广阔的区块链生态,与其他应用和服务进行联接,提升用户的使用体验。例如,轻可与去中心化交易所(DEX)、预言机等进行深度集成,便于用户实时交易。

                  ### 用户需求变化

                  随着用户对数字资产管理需求的提升,轻的功能应不断适应市场变化,提供更友好的用户体验。企业应时刻关注用户反馈,快速迭代产品,予以最佳服务。

                  ## 常见问题解答 ### 以太坊轻的安全性如何?

                  以太坊轻的安全性如何?

                  以太坊轻的安全性是用户最为关注的问题之一。它通过多重技术手段保护用户资产。

                  首先,轻在数据传输过程中使用HTTPS加密,确保与服务器的数据传输不被窃听;其次,私钥存储采用设备本地加密而非云端储存,避免黑客攻击的直接影响。此外,定期的安全审计和更新能够有效减少潜在的 vulnerabilities。

                  轻还可配备实时监测和异常行为检测系统,能够在用户资产安全受到威胁时及时发出警报,帮助用户及时采取措施。同时,支持多重签名和助记词的方式也能够增强用户的资产安全性。

                  ### 轻与全节点哪个更安全?

                  轻与全节点哪个更安全?

                  全节点因其存储完整区块链数据的特性,在理论上可提供更高的安全性。用户完全依赖本地数据进行交易验证,而不需要信任其他节点,因此不容易受到来自外部的攻击。不论是重放攻击还是真实数据篡改,全节点具有更高的防御能力。

                  然而,轻更注重用户体验和方便性。在许多情况下,轻采用精简的验证机制是为了便于用户。但这也使得轻可能相对更依赖于网络安全,这使得其潜在的风险有所提升。

                  总的来说,全节点在安全性上具有优势,但由于其存储需求高,在用户使用体验上不及轻。因此,如果用户对于安全性有极高的需求,建议使用全节点;但对于普通用户而言,轻则成为了一种更加便利的选择。

                  ### 如何选择适合自己需求的轻?

                  如何选择适合自己需求的轻?

                  选择轻时需考虑多个因素,包括安全性、用户体验、功能性等。

                  首先,调查不同轻的安全性,优先选择那些提供强力加密和多重验证机制的。此外,还要关注开发团队的安全史及用户评价。

                  其次,用户体验也是重要考量,的界面应简洁易用,操作流畅,同时具备友好的交互设计,方便用户完成日常交易。

                  功能性方面,用户需确认轻是否支持自身需要的功能,如多币种支持、交易迅速、资产查阅是否便捷等。

                  最后,建议参考多方资源,如网络评测和社区反馈,全面比较各款,选择出最符合自己需求的轻。

                  ### 如何确保轻中的资产安全?

                  如何确保轻中的资产安全?

                  确保轻中资产安全并不是单一操作,而是多方位的安全措施结合。

                  首先,用户应确保轻本身是来自合法的官方渠道下载,避免使用未受信任的来源。同时,及时更新应用,利用更新带来的安全补丁来保护资产安全。

                  其次,定期备份的数据及私钥,可以避免因设备损坏等情况导致资产丢失。保留助记词并储存于安全的地方,防止他人获取。

                  在交易时,警惕钓鱼网站和恶意链接,以免泄露个人信息或资产。此外,使用VPN进行网络交易及公用网络时增加安全性。最终,用户应定期检查账户活动,及时发现并应对异常交易。

                  ### 以太坊轻的开发费用大概多少?

                  以太坊轻的开发费用大概多少?

                  以太坊轻的开发费用主要取决于开发团队的规模、所选功能、技术难度等因素。

                  一般而言,一个基本功能的轻开发费用在几千到几万美元不等。如果包括复杂功能如多重签名、集成DApp、支持多币种等,开发费用可能会大幅增加,达到几万到十几万美元。

                  开发时间也会影响费用,通常,一个完整的轻项目需要3-6个月的开发周期,包含需求评估、编码、测试及迭代的时间。

                  需求的复杂程度以及所需的开发语言技术栈直接影响人力成本,若企业选择外包开发,可以减少固定成本,但需要注意选择有信誉的公司合作,以确保最终产品的质量。

                  ### 有哪些成功的轻开发案例?

                  有哪些成功的轻开发案例?

                  成功的轻不仅满足用户需求,还能在市场上占有一席之地。比如以太坊生态中有几个突出的轻开发案例。

                  MetaMask 是一个著名的以太坊轻,其具备强大的浏览器插件功能,方便用户在多个去中心化应用和NFT平台上进行交互。同时,MetaMask 的用户界面友好,具备简化的交易流程,受到广泛欢迎。

                  另外,Trust Wallet 是由币安推出的一款轻,支持多种数字货币。其因操作简便和良好安全性吸引了大量用户。同时,Trust Wallet还与多条公链互动,成为去中心化交易所的门户。

                  区块链行业持续进步,各类轻在技术和功能上也不断革新,满足了不断变化的市场需求。这些成功案例鼓励开发者不断创新,推动轻领域的进一步发展。

                  ``` 以上内容包含了整个以太坊轻开发的各个方面,包括基本概念、开发流程、安全性考虑和市场趋势等,满足2700字以上的要求,并逐一回答了六个相关问题。
                  • Tags
                  • 以太坊轻,区块链开发,安全,去中心化应用
                            <code date-time="8jl9pi"></code><address id="m0uffq"></address><u dropzone="q4efda"></u><big lang="y8mwb8"></big><ol dropzone="0mvkta"></ol><em id="ri4l28"></em><abbr draggable="1i4oxo"></abbr><noscript dropzone="_di6vk"></noscript><time dir="m3_893"></time><pre lang="ipq_k5"></pre><noframes dropzone="bitxib">